Orientation evolution of single-crystal superalloys under different solidification interface

2014 
The single-crystal superalloys with different deviation angle are prepared by using the liquid metal cooling high-temperature gradient directional solidification furnace, and the orientation evolution of single-crystal superalloys under different solidification interface is studied. The results indicate that the increase of the deviation angle will make the planar interface unstable. With the increase of the solidification rate, the growth direction of the crystal will deviate from the direction of heat flow to the preferred orientation direction. Under the developed dendrite crystal growth, the branches of the dendrite will follow the preferred orientation, nearly free from the effect of the heat flow.
